[发明专利]云服务器操作系统及方法无效
申请号: | 201010586072.0 | 申请日: | 2010-12-14 |
公开(公告)号: | CN102541625A | 公开(公告)日: | 2012-07-04 |
发明(设计)人: | 李雪愚 | 申请(专利权)人: | 盛乐信息技术(上海)有限公司 |
主分类号: | G06F9/46 | 分类号: | G06F9/46;G06F9/48 |
代理公司: | 上海浦一知识产权代理有限公司 31211 | 代理人: | 孙大为 |
地址: | 201203 上*** | 国省代码: | 上海;31 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 服务器 操作系统 方法 | ||
技术领域
本发明涉及一种操作系统及方法,具体涉及一种服务器操作系统及方法。
背景技术
云计算(Cloud Computing)是分布式计算(Distributed Computing)、并行计算(Parallel Computing)和网格计算(Grid Computing)的发展,其基本原理是将计算任务通过网络分配给多台计算机执行,每台计算机称为云计算网络的一个节点。
现有的云计算网络中,存在各种运行于不同操作系统上的服务应用,这意味着对网络管理的复杂性的增加和安全性降低。目前,市场上出现了利用虚拟机来虚拟运行不同的操作系统,模拟操作系统指令的方式来实现的。常见的虚拟化技术是指CPU虚拟化,通过虚拟多个CPU来同时运行多个操作系统,使得每一个操作系统都运行在一个或多个虚拟的CPU上。不过这就意味着对服务性能的大大降低,以及必需在每一个虚拟机上分别安装独立的操作系统,极大的浪费了存储空间。
在云计算网络中,为了解决在一个操作系统下面无需虚拟化即可同时运行不同操作系统的服务应用程序,本发明提供了一种云服务器操作系统及其方法。
发明内容
本发明所要解决的技术问题是提供一种云服务器操作系统,其可以在一个操作系统下面无需要虚拟化并且无需要针对每一个虚拟环境安装不同的操作系统,但是却能同时运行不同操作系统的服务应用,该系统部署于云计算网络的服务器上,在无需安装其他操作系统的前提下,以极高的效率运行各种操作系统的服务。
为了解决以上技术问题,本发明提供了一种云服务器操作系统,所述系统部署于云计算网络的服务器上,所述系统包括:Host内核模块,其为可配置的多任务操作系统底层;安全模块:实现强制访问控制体制;系统服务内核模块,其为可加载式核心模块,通过加载不同的操作系统插接模块,直接在云服务操作系统上运行该操作系统下的服务程序。
本发明的有益效果在于:可以在一个操作系统下面无需要虚拟化并且无需要针对每一个虚拟环境安装不同的操作系统,但是却能同时运行不同操作系统的服务应用,该系统部署于云计算网络的服务器上,在无需安装其他操作系统的前提下,以极高的效率运行各种操作系统的服务。
本发明还提供了上述云服务器操作系统的实现方法,包括如下步骤:
第1步,启动Host内核操作系统;
第2步,Host操作系统内核加载安全模块;
第3步,Host操作系统内核加载相应的系统服务内核适配器模块;
第4步,根据不同的执行文件格式执行不同操作系统的服务应用,首先对执行文件的二进制映像格式进行识别,然后判定是哪一种对应的内核适配器模块。
第5步,检查服务应用的对应的系统内核适配器模块是否存在和启用;
第6步,如果启用则根据制定的安全策略执行该服务应用。
附图说明
下面结合附图和具体实施方式对本发明作进一步详细说明。
图1是本发明实施例所述云服务器操作系统的示意图;
图2是本发明实施例所述云服务器操作方法的示意图。
具体实施方式
本发明公开了一种云服务器操作系统,其部署于云计算网络的各服务节点上,在无需安装其他操作系统的前提下,以极高的效率运行各种操作系统(Linux,Windows,BSD等)的服务,从而降低成本提高效率。
如图1所示,所述系统包括:Host内核模块,安全模块,操作系统服务内核模块(Linux,Windows,BSD等)。Host内核模块:实质是高度可配置的POSIX(Portable Operating System Interface)多任务操作系统核心;操作系统服务内核适配器模块(Linux,Windows,BSD等):是可加载式核心适配器模块,实际上,Linux,windows,BSD的API只是有差别,但是各个操作系统都已经实现类似的功能,只是调用的方式或步骤有所不同,所以该“适配器”模块顾名思义就是将不同操作系统的内核调用,通过“适配器”转换为本操作系统的内核调用形式,从而达到加载不同的操作系统插接模块,来实现直接在云服务操作系统上运行该操作系统下的服务程序的目的。安全模块:实现了高强度但又灵活的强制访问控制(MAC)体制,提供基于机密性和完整性的信息隔离,能对抗欺骗和试图旁路安全机的威胁,限制了因恶意代码和应用程序缺陷造成的危害。支持多种安全策略模型,支持策略的灵活改变,使用类型裁决和基于角色的访问控制来配置系统;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于盛乐信息技术(上海)有限公司,未经盛乐信息技术(上海)有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201010586072.0/2.html,转载请声明来源钻瓜专利网。
- 上一篇:高强度电机转子体
- 下一篇:热电池CoS2正极材料的配方及处理工艺